python代码文件转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ller,这三种方式各有千秋,本人只用过py2exe和cxfreeze,这里重点说明cxfreeze。 2、安装包下载地址 https://sourceforge.net/projects/cx-freeze/files/ 3、cxfree的官方说明文档 http://cx-freeze.readthedocs.io/en/latest/distutils.html 二、cxfree...
python代码文件转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ller,这三种方式各有千秋,本人只用过py2exe和cxfreeze,这里重点说明cxfreeze。 2、安装包下载地址 https://sourceforge.net/projects/cx-freeze/files/ 3、cxfree的官方说明文档 http://cx-freeze.readthedocs.io/en/latest/distutils.html 二、cxfree...
from cx_Freeze import setup, Executable# 依赖的模块列表build_exe_options = {"packages": ["os"], # 在这里添加你的依赖模块"excludes": [] # 在这里添加不需要包含的模块}# 设置打包选项setup( name = "hello", version = "0.1", description = "My first cx_Freeze app!", o...
cx_Freeze 打包生成Linux可执行文件 准备一台linux系统环境 安装cx_Freeze pip install cx_Freeze 准备两个py脚本 1,app应用脚本,需要打包的 app.py importrandomimporttimefromflaskimportFlask, jsonifyfromconcurrent.futuresimportThreadPoolExecutor app = Flask(__name__) executor = ThreadPoolExecutor()@app.rout...
鄙人推荐使用cx_freeze进行打包,有点就是没有前两个的缺点,应该足够优秀了。 1. Installation Pip 安装最新版本的cx_Freeze pip install --upgrade cx_freeze 建议 在虚环境中独立安装cx_freeze,这样打包时就是从virtual environment中复制需要import的模块,否则就要从python sdk中复制需要的模块,venv的好处还是大大的...
在python中比较常用的python转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ller。但后两种似乎对python3的支持部不好,而且操作也没cx_freeze简单,所以我选择cx_freeze来打包我的python程序。 1. 首先安装cx_freeze这个包: pip install cx_freeze 2. 解包,输入以下命令会在python的scripts文件夹下生成cxfreeze.bat...
将Python程序生成exe程序目前流行这三种: cx_freeze py2exe Pyinstaller,后面两种支持python3有些问题,推荐使用cx_Freeze打包。 目录 cx_Freeze简介 cx_Freeze安装 cx_Freeze使用 cx_Freeze简介 一种打包工具的库,将我们写的py文件编译成可执行文件,例如在windws...
在python中比较常用的python转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ller。但后两种似乎对python3的支持部不好,而且操作也没cx_freeze简单,所以我选择cx_freeze来打包我的python程序。 1. 首先安装cx_freeze这个包: pip install cx_freeze 2. 解包,输入以下命令会在python的scripts文件夹下生成cxfreeze.bat...
在python中比较常用的python转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ller。但后两种似乎对python3的支持部不好,而且操作也没cx_freeze简单,所以我选择cx_freeze来打包我的python程序。 1. 首先安装cx_freeze这个包: pip install cx_freeze 2. 解包,输入以下命令会在python的scripts文件夹下生成cxfreeze.bat...
cxfreeze有两种打包方式,一是cxfreeze script,这种方式很简单,只要打开cmd,cd到python文件所在目录,比如文件名为hello.py,执行: cxfreeze hello.py --target-dir dist 如果要生成可安装包文件,就要用到这种打包方式,名为distutils setup script,这种方式必须创建一个setup.py文件,可以使用官方提供的: ...